Size: a a a

NodeUA - JavaScript and Node.js in Ukraine

2022 January 18

˸A

˸̧̨ ͅBlack Akula˸̧̨ ... in NodeUA - JavaScript and Node.js in Ukraine
Я наоборот весь код на стримах(ивенты)/коллбек переделываю на промисы
источник

СП

Сергей Пограничный... in NodeUA - JavaScript and Node.js in Ukraine
Хорошо, как вы асинхронно итерируетесь по коллекциям с помощью промисов?
источник

FS

Fedir Smilianets in NodeUA - JavaScript and Node.js in Ukraine
observable > promise
источник

FS

Fedir Smilianets in NodeUA - JavaScript and Node.js in Ukraine
ось вони якраз шикарно справляються з асинхронним ітеруванням
источник

˸A

˸̧̨ ͅBlack Akula˸̧̨ ... in NodeUA - JavaScript and Node.js in Ukraine
Да. Но ещё видел код, где промис с генератором совмещён. Вот генераторы как раз с пррмисами хорошо сочетаются
источник

A

Alexander in NodeUA - JavaScript and Node.js in Ukraine
это чтоль из говнолибы рхжс?
источник

FS

Fedir Smilianets in NodeUA - JavaScript and Node.js in Ukraine
так а чого говноліба-то?
источник

˸A

˸̧̨ ͅBlack Akula˸̧̨ ... in NodeUA - JavaScript and Node.js in Ukraine
Скорее редакс либ все вспомнили (observable/саги)
источник

СП

Сергей Пограничный... in NodeUA - JavaScript and Node.js in Ukraine
И не стыдно в чате Тимура говорить о зависимостях? 😁
источник

А

Арсений in NodeUA - JavaScript and Node.js in Ukraine
а он может про свою реализацию говорит? observable это всего лишь паттерн)
источник

СП

Сергей Пограничный... in NodeUA - JavaScript and Node.js in Ukraine
Тогда это сверхабстрактный ответ, мы то все поняли, что он хотел
источник

СП

Сергей Пограничный... in NodeUA - JavaScript and Node.js in Ukraine
стримы это тот же самый паттерн, я про них и спросил
источник

FS

Fedir Smilianets in NodeUA - JavaScript and Node.js in Ukraine
А чого має буть стидно?

Хороша депенденсі краща за відро велосипедів. Якщо маєш багато асинхронних задач -- не бачу ніякої проблеми в rxjs, бо це дійсно топовий тулкіт який з коробки спрощує і робить код набагато більш елегантним і виразним
источник

СП

Сергей Пограничный... in NodeUA - JavaScript and Node.js in Ukraine
Я тоже так думал, но посмотрите как метархия выглядит репа и какого качества там тулы и код, ждем метархию в топах techempower.
источник

А

Арсений in NodeUA - JavaScript and Node.js in Ukraine
источник

FS

Fedir Smilianets in NodeUA - JavaScript and Node.js in Ukraine
Лінку гляну, але я сиджу чисто з власного досвіду використання
источник

h

hilarion_von_juzefin... in NodeUA - JavaScript and Node.js in Ukraine
привіт
створюю вотакий вот сервер
const server = new Hapi.Server({});
server.connection({ port: 8081, host: '0.0.0.0' });
є роут /ping, який повертає pong.
команда curl  0.0.0.0:8081/ping повертає curl: (7) Failed to connect to 0.0.0.0 port 8081: Address not available
запит у браузері http://0.0.0.0:8081/ping повертає ERR_ADDRESS_INVALID
Проте команда wsl curl 0.0.0.0:8081/ping повертає, як і потрібно, pong
Запит в Postman GET http://0.0.0.0:8081/ping також повертає pong
це може бути пов'язано із налаштуваннями DNS чи чимось таким?
источник

A

Alexander in NodeUA - JavaScript and Node.js in Ukraine
источник

FS

Fedir Smilianets in NodeUA - JavaScript and Node.js in Ukraine
останній раз як спілкувався з кимось з метархії мені сказали шо воно поки ще зовсім не готове до використання в проді кимось крім них
источник

h

hilarion_von_juzefin... in NodeUA - JavaScript and Node.js in Ukraine
зрозумів, спасибі
источник